Motion text
That this house commends the Scotch whisky industry for their remarkable success in hitting record high exports last year; recognises the significant contribution this industry brings to the UK economy with exports of £4.7 billion; highlights the role Diageo, based in Edinburgh West, has played in this growth with their six per cent increase in Scotch sales in 2018 and the noteworthy role played by this company in wider society through their aims of building stronger communities, enhancing the positive role of alcohol and protecting the environment; expresses concern at the current uncertainty Brexit is creating for this industry as the EU is the largest regional importer of Scotch whisky; and hopes that the Government will create the favourable conditions necessary to ensure this industry continues to have optimum opportunities for growth within this competitive market.
